Openai’s co -founder, Ilya Sutskever, says he enters the role of CEO in Safe supervisionThe start of AI launched in 2024. In a position on X, Sutskever confirmed on Thursday that Daniel Gross, co -founder and chief executive of the start, departed from the company from June 29.
The announcement follows weeks of reference that Meta Mark Zuckerberg CEO was in advanced talks to hire Gross, as well as his long -term investment partner, a former CEO of GitHub Nat Friedman. At one point, Zuckerberg tried to get all the safe supernatural, a startup that is recently estimated at $ 32 billion. Sutskever also addressed these reports.
“You may have heard rumors about the companies they want to get. We are flattered by their attention, but they focus on seeing our work,” Sutskever said. “We have the calculation, we have the team and we know what to do. Together we will continue to build safe supervision.”
